Kathy Ireland Biography

Short Biography

Kathy Ireland (born Kathleen Marie Ireland on March 20 1963 in Santa Barbara, California) was dubbed by Forbes[2] and Newsweek[3] magazine “supermodel-turned-super mogul who has built a business that generates $1.4 billion in retail sales." She followed her initial acclaim by becoming one of the most successful female entrepreneurs and designers in the world, resulting in her being named as the only woman in Inc magazine’s top five celebrity entrepreneurs. Ireland has an honorary Masters Degree from American InterContinental University. She is Chief Designer and CEO of Kathy Ireland Worldwide, a design and marketing firm, whose mission is Women’s Wear Daily, acknowledged her Brand as America’s 7th most popular in its category. Kurt Solomon and Associated named Ireland’s Brand as number one in product innovation, number one in percentage increase of customer loyalty and fifth most recognized brand with women 18 to 49.

Ireland’s designs has appeared in a number of magazines including: Cosmopolitan, Glamour, McCalls, People, Redbook, Shape Fit Pregnancy, Harper’s Bazaar, and Vanity Fair. She has appeared as a guest on MSNBC, CNBC, The Today Show, Oprah, Larry King, Access Hollywood and Main Floor and has had specials on E!, [[VH1] ]and Entertainment Tonight. In addition, she has also been featured in Business Week, Parade, The New York Times and The Washington Post, Forbes, and Inc Magazine.

Internationally, the Kathy Ireland Brand appears in Elle, Hola, Marie Claire, Latina, Cosmopolitan, People Espanol and Harper’s Bazaar. It has received postive reviews from Good Housekeeping, Latina, Cosmopolitan, Glamour, Crecer Feliz, People Espanol and Teen People en Espanol.
Kathy Ireland is also a motivational speaker. She has appeared at the United Nations speaking to the 4th Annual Youth Assembly addressing how to achieve the Eight Millennium Goals. She was the key note speaker at the Office Depot Success Strategies for Women Conference with Dr. Maya Angelou and Barbara Walters and gave the key note address’ for the Ernst and Young Entrepreneur Awards, Comerica Bank’s Women’s Initiative and the Women in the Millionaire Zone events. She is the godmother of Carnival cruise lines 22nd ship, the M.S. Carnival Freedom
